HOW TO ADDRESS PSYCHOLOGICAL FACTORS THAT LEAD TO SEXUAL BOREDOM IN LONGTERM RELATIONSHIPS?

Sexual boredom is a common problem that many couples face in long-term relationships. It is characterized by a lack of excitement, satisfaction, or fulfillment during sexual encounters and can lead to apathy, frustration, and resentment between partners. While there are several possible causes for sexual boredom, including physical changes, stress, communication issues, and external factors, psychological dynamics play an important role in its development and maintenance. This article will explore some of the most significant psychological factors that contribute to sexual boredom in long-term relationships and provide strategies for addressing it collaboratively.

Physical Changes

One major contributor to sexual boredom is physical changes that occur over time. As individuals age, their bodies may change in ways that affect their ability to experience pleasure during sex.

Women may experience vaginal dryness or reduced sensitivity due to hormonal shifts, while men may experience decreased testosterone levels, which can impact their libido. These physical changes can make sexual activity less enjoyable and lead to feelings of dissatisfaction and boredom.

These changes can be addressed through lifestyle adjustments, such as incorporating lubricants or other products into sexual activities.

Couples can work together to find new ways to stimulate each other's bodies, such as exploring different positions or using sex toys.

Stress and Anxiety

Stress and anxiety can also contribute to sexual boredom. When individuals feel overwhelmed by life's demands, they may lose interest in sex because it feels like one more task on their to-do list. Further, stress can interfere with arousal and desire, making it difficult to engage in sexual encounters. Couples can address this issue by prioritizing relaxation techniques, such as deep breathing exercises or meditation, before engaging in sexual activity. They can also explore nonsexual forms of intimacy, such as cuddling or massages, to reduce tension and increase bonding.

Communication Issues

Another psychological factor contributing to sexual boredom is communication issues between partners. If individuals do not communicate openly about their needs, desires, and preferences, they may struggle to maintain a satisfying sexual relationship. This can lead to misunderstandings, frustration, and resentment. To address this issue, couples should establish clear boundaries and expectations around sex and be willing to communicate honestly and vulnerably with each other.

They can set aside time for regular check-ins to discuss their sexual experiences and desires. They can also experiment with new activities, such as role-playing or sensory play, to keep things interesting.

External Factors

External factors, such as work, family obligations, or health concerns, can also impact sexual boredom. When individuals are preoccupied with external stressors, they may have less energy or focus on their relationships, including their sexual ones. Addressing these factors requires collaboration between partners. They can seek support from friends or family members or engage in self-care practices, such as exercise or hobbies, to manage stress levels. By working together to address external factors, couples can create space for more meaningful and fulfilling sexual encounters.

Sexual boredom is a complex problem that requires collaboration between partners to address. Couples can work together to identify the underlying causes of their sexual boredom and explore strategies to rekindle the spark in their relationship. Through open communication, physical adjustments, relaxation techniques, and self-care practices, couples can overcome sexual boredom and reconnect emotionally and physically.
